12-18-2018 City Council Meeting HOPKINS CITY COUNCIL REGULAR MEETING PROCEEDINGS DECEMBER 18, 2018 CALL TO ORDER Pursuant to due call and notice thereof a regular meeting of the Hopkins City Council was held on Tuesday, December 18, 2018 at 7:00 p.m. in the Council Chambers at City Hall, 1010 First Street South, Hopkins. Mayor Cummings called the meeting to order with Council Members Kuznia, Halverson, Gadd, Hunke attending. Staff present included City Manager Mornson, Finance Director Bishop and Public Works Director Stadler. ADOPT AGENDA Motion by Gadd. Second by Hunke. Motion to Adopt Agenda. Ayes: Kuznia, Halverson, Cummings, Gadd, Hunke. Nays: None. Motion carried. CONSENT AGENDA Motion by Kuznia. Second by Halverson. Motion to Approve the Consent Agenda. 1. Minutes of the December 4, 2018 City Council Regular Meeting Proceedings 2. Minutes of the December 4, 2018 City Council Work Session following Regular Meeting Proceedings 3. Minutes of the December 11, 2018 City Council Work Session Proceedings 4. Renewal for General Liability and Property Insurance and Authorize Not Waiving the Statutory Tort Liability Coverage on League of Minnesota Insurance Trust Policy Ayes: Kuznia, Halverson, Cummings, Gadd, Hunke. Nays: None. Motion carried. NEW BUSINESS VITA. Water and Sanitary Sewer Rate Increases Finance Director Bishop discussed the staff report regarding the proposed water and sanitary sewer rate increase. Mr. Bishop commented that the proposed rate increase is based on the Utility Rate Study and the ongoing operational and capital needs in the water and sewer funds. Mr. Bishop discussed the proposed increases, impacts to users and the tiered rate structure. Mr. Bishop commented that the rates are calculated on a monthly basis. Motion by Gadd. Second by Hunke. Motion to Adopt Resolution 2018-091 Increasing Water and Sanitary Sewer Rates Effective January 1, 2019. HOPKINS CITY COUNCIL REGULAR MEETING PROCEEDINGS DECEMBER 18, 2018 Ayes: Kuznia, Halverson, Cummings, Gadd, Hunke. Nays: None. Motion carried ANNOUNCEMENTS • City Hall will be closed on December 24, 25, 31 and January 1. • The next City Council meeting will be held on Wednesday, January 2, 2019 at 7 p.m. • City Hall services available at the Fire Station starting Wednesday, January 2, 2019 until the City Hall remodel is complete. • On behalf of the City Council, Mayor Cummings wished everyone a happy and healthy 2019. ADJOURNMENT There being no further business to come before the City Council and upon a motion by Kuznia, second by Hunke, the meeting was unanimously adjourned at 7:07 p.m. OPEN AGENDA— PUBLIC COMMENTS AND CONCERNS The City Council did not receive any comments or concerns.
